## Tuning: Image Slimming

Quick update for the sync: the Fernwick base images were getting chunky again, so we turned the slimmer back on for all Quillbot services. The big wins come from layer squashing and pruning the apt cache, but the knobs matter — squash too aggressively and rebuild times explode. Petra benchmarked a bunch of combos on the Larkspur cluster last week and we landed on a sane middle ground. The constants we settled on are below.

tuning constants:
QUOTAS = {
    "druwyn": 5,
    "holix": 5,
    "zorath": 5,
    "holwyn": 10,
}

Onboarding: Millgrain transcode farm

Millgrain converts uploads into our delivery ladder. Jobs queue through the Coldbarrow scheduler; priority is set by tier, not upload time. Don't requeue stuck jobs manually — use the reaper tool. Capacity dashboards, codec presets, and the failure-code glossary are all on the internal page linked below.

dashboard of kafop-yagep = https://jira.zemvarsys.internal/pages/pages/pages/display/cc87

**Handover: Grainport CSV Import Wizard**

Handing this to the plugin-facing side. The wizard now runs column-mapping plugins in a sandboxed pass before commit, so your validators see raw rows, not normalized ones — adjust accordingly. Delimiter sniffing was moved into core; plugins can no longer override it. Malformed-row hooks fire once per batch, not per row. Everything else matches the published interface. The current wizard runtime settings are reproduced below.

settings of fafog-haduf:
ZORIX_PIN=4648
ZORIX_METRICS_HOST=metrics.zorix.paliqsys.corp
ZORIX_LOG_LEVEL=info
ZORIX_TENANT=druix

Visitors and contractors attending Fenwick Rise outside core hours must be pre-registered by their sponsoring department. Night-shift support personnel from Ardell Technical may enter between 21:00 and 06:00 via the east lobby only. All persons sign the overnight register, wear issued lanyards at all times, and remain within the floors listed on their work order. Escorts are not provided overnight. To release the east lobby inner door during these hours, contractors should enter the code below.

staff pass of kawip-hawef = bdg-QLP-2